What are the typical daily responsibilities for someone working in corrugated boxes production?

Corrugated boxes production roles often involve operating machinery to cut, fold, and assemble cardboard into shipping boxes, inspecting products for quality, and packaging finished goods for distribution. Team members frequently rotate between stations, handle stacking or organizing finished boxes, and keep their workspace clean and safe. You will also be expected to follow safety protocols and report any equipment issues to supervisors. The pace can be fast, especially during peak shipping seasons, but teamwork and communication are key to staying efficient and meeting production goals.

What is a Corrugated Boxes job?

A Corrugated Boxes job typically involves manufacturing, assembling, or handling corrugated cardboard packaging. Workers may operate machinery, design box structures, or manage logistics for shipping and storage. Roles vary from production line workers to quality control inspectors and packaging engineers. These jobs are essential in industries like shipping, retail, and e-commerce, ensuring products are safely transported and stored.
